Dundalk High School is a four-year public high school in the United States, located in Baltimore County, Maryland. The school opened in 1959. Starting in 2010, DHS was rebuilt and combined with Sollers Point Technical High School. The new building opened in 2013.
Serving 2,159 students in grades 9-12, Dundalk High School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Maryland for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 4% (which is lower than the Maryland state average of 27%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 34% (which is lower than the Maryland state average of 45%).
The student-teacher ratio of 16:1 is higher than the Maryland state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 72%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Maryland state average of 68% (majority Black and Hispanic).

Dundalk High School's student population of 2,159 students has grown by 17% over five school years.
The teacher population of 136 teachers has grown by 9% over five school years.
